BCCI discussing Ryan ten Doeschate and Morne Morkel's future as Team India coaches; T Dilip under fire
Indian cricket team head coach Gautam Gambhir, team’s bowling coach Morne Morkel, team’s assistant coach Ryan Ten Doeschate and player Ravindra Jadeja (ANI Photo)

New Delhi: The Indian cricket board (BCCI) may have to work overtime to get the support staff for the Indian team in order after the conclusion of the ongoing England tour. TOI understands that assistant coach Ryan ten Doeschate and fast bowling coach Morne Morkel are contemplating moving on from their respective roles once their contracts expire after the ODI series in England this month. “Doeschate isn’t very sure of continuing with this job. He has conveyed his problems with travelling with the team throughout the year. Morkel is still weighing his options. The board is discussing the matter with the two coaches and will try to see if things can be sorted out,” a BCCI source told TOI. The Indian team is due to leave for Sri Lanka for a two-Test series in the first week of Aug. Cricket head at the Centre of Excellence (CoE) VVS Laxman will take his CoE coaching staff with him for India’s three-match T20I series in Zimbabwe in the last week of July. Sources said that Doeschate may be in talks with an IPL franchise, while Morkel hasn’t said anything firmly yet. Head coach Gautam Gambhir had handpicked these two coaches when he took charge in July 2024. The BCCI has always endorsed support staff coming through its coaching programme at the CoE. Last year, Abhishek Nayar was replaced by Sitanshu Kotak as batting coach. If things aren’t resolved with Doeschate and Morkel, the BCCI may be forced to send Lakshmipathy Balaji, who was recently appointed as the fast bowling coach at the CoE, to Sri Lanka. Fielding coach under fire TOI has also learnt that fielding coach T Dilip is under pressure to save his job. The board is not happy with the team’s deteriorating fielding standards. Dilip got a reprieve last year after being sacked along with Nayar.
